The Nutritional Breakdown of Quest Peanut Butter Cups
One of the main reasons people gravitate towards Quest Peanut Butter Cups is their impressive nutritional profile. Let’s take a closer look at what makes these treats different from traditional candy:
Quest Peanut Butter Cups Nutrition Facts
A regular-sized Quest Peanut Butter Cup typically contains:
- Calories: 200-210 per cup
- Protein: 12g
- Total Carbohydrates: 12-13g
- Fiber: 9-10g
- Sugars: 1g
- Fat: 16g (with a good portion coming from healthy fats like peanuts)
For the Quest Mini Peanut Butter Cups, the nutritional profile is scaled down, but you still get a solid dose of protein and fiber in every mini cup:
- Calories: 90-100 per mini cup
- Protein: 6g
- Total Carbohydrates: 6-7g
- Fiber: 4g
- Sugars: 1g
- Fat: 8g
As you can see, Quest Peanut Butter Cups are packed with protein and fiber, which makes them a much healthier option compared to the typical candy cup. Plus, the low sugar content makes them a great choice for anyone trying to cut back on sugar intake.

Are Quest Peanut Butter Cups Bad for You?
While Quest Peanut Butter Cups are definitely a healthier snack option, there are a few considerations to keep in mind before indulging. Are they bad for you? Let’s explore some potential drawbacks:
Potential Drawbacks:
- Sugar Alcohols: While sugar alcohols like erythritol are used to keep the sugar content low, some people may experience digestive issues such as bloating or gas when consuming products with sugar alcohols. This is something to be aware of, especially if you’re sensitive to these ingredients.
- Caloric Density: Despite being lower in sugar, Quest Peanut Butter Cups are still calorie-dense. A single cup contains around 200 calories, so it’s important to factor these into your overall daily calorie intake if you’re watching your calories closely.
- Portion Control: If you find yourself eating multiple cups at once (which can be tempting because they taste so good), it could lead to overeating. It’s important to keep portion control in mind when enjoying these treats.
Bottom Line:
While Quest Peanut Butter Cups aren’t “bad” for you, they should still be consumed in moderation, especially if you’re trying to lose weight or follow a strict diet. The key to making these a part of a healthy lifestyle is balance.
